- Background: Infection is one of the biggest factors that causes high number of illness and mortality. Staphylococcus aures is the bacterial which is frequently found in infection case. One of the plants that can be used to treat the infection is Piper betle L. Objective: This current study aimed to find out the bacterial activity by measuring inhibition zone diameter from ethanol fraction of Piper betle L. through the growth of Staphylococcus aureus and to find out the compound classification of the ethanol fraction. Method: Activity test of bacterial applied disc diffusion method. The ethanol fraction of Piper betle L. was obtained by conducting multilevel macerate and KLT test was conducted to indentify secondary metabolites compound. Result and Conclusion: Identification result of secondary metabolites showed that ethanol fraction of Piper betle L. contained alkaloids, terpenoids, polyphenols, and anthraquinone compound. In addition, the bacterial activity test result described that the average of inhibition zone diameter in concentration 250 mg/ml (12,5 mg/disc) has diameter 7,13 mm, concentration 500 mg/ml (25 mg/disc) has diameter 7,72 mm, and concentration 750 mg/ml (37,5 mg/disc) has diameter 8,48 mm, however positive control amoxicillin and clavulanic acid (30 μg/disc) was 24,92 mm. The conclusion of this reseacrh antibacterial was the average of inhibition zone diameter including the resistant category.
